Orano Med is seeking an Instrumentation Specialist for radiopharmaceutical manufacturing at ATLab Indianapolis ("ATLab IND"), a new facility for commercial-scale manufacturing of sterile therapeutic radiopharmaceuticals. The Instrumentation Specialist will be responsible for maintaining, calibrating, and ensuring the accurate operation of critical laboratory instrumentation. This position presents the opportunity to help establish a new facility that will meet high standards for quantity, speed, and reliability. Responsibilities
Perform routine maintenance, calibration, and troubleshooting of HPLC systems, lab balances, particle counters, viable air samplers, BMS, and various sensors. Ensure all instrumentation operates within specified parameters and maintains accurate records of maintenance and calibration activities. Conduct temperature mapping for storage areas, equipment, and facilities to ensure compliance with regulatory requirements. Ensure all instrumentation activities comply with relevant regulatory standards (e.g., FDA, GMP, ISO). Diagnose and resolve technical issues with instrumentation, working with vendors and service providers as necessary. Remote work may be possible when the facility is under construction.

Ideal qualifications
Qualifications Required Education
- Bachelor's degree in Chemistry, Engineering, or a related technical field.
Experience
3-5 years of experience working with laboratory instrumentation in a pharmaceutical or radiopharmaceutical environment. Cleanroom operations: gowning, cleaning, EM, aseptic technique. Experience with HPLC, Radiochemistry QC Instruments, Particle Counters, Lab Balances, Pipettes, Viable Air Samplers
Preferred Experience
- Strong understanding of instrument calibration, maintenance, and troubleshooting.
- Experience with BMS and Sensors + CMMS.
- Safety: occupational, laboratory, chemical, radiation
- Production of radiopharmaceuticals
- IT/IS: eBR, eQMS, EMS, etc.
